SPEAKING OF SNOW …

Not much good to say about 2020, and that includes the amount of precipitation we’ve received. The Yampa and White basin is sitting at just 64% of normal snow water equivalent (SWE) for this time of year on the USDA NRCS SNOTEL map as of Dec. 22. In case you’ve[Read More…]

EARLY CHRISTMAS …

200 doses of the Moderna vaccine for COVID-19 arrived at RBC Public Health Tuesday. Immunizations begin Monday for residents in Phase 1A. More info. on the vaccine and the distribution schedule is available at https://covid19.colorado.gov/vaccine
